Interventions

  • Black Breast Cancer Survivor's Intervention — BEHAVIORAL
    Participants will complete the BBCSI course (1-hour virtual sessions every week for 6 weeks), answer questionnaires before and after the course, and provide urine samples.

Study Details

The goal of this research study is to learn about the effects of the BBCSI course on the quality of life of Black breast cancer survivors. A community-based and peer-led Black Breast Cancer Survivor's Intervention (BBCSI) course has been developed to help improve the quality of life of Black breast cancer survivors.
